##### http://autoconf-archive.cryp.to/ax_c_arithmetic_rshift.html # # SYNOPSIS # # AX_C_ARITHMETIC_RSHIFT # # DESCRIPTION # # Checks if the right shift operation is arithmetic. # # This macro uses compile-time detection and so is cross-compile # ready. # # LAST MODIFICATION # # 2006-12-12 # # COPYLEFT # # Copyright (c) 2006 YAMAMOTO Kengo # # Copying and distribution of this file, with or without # modification, are permitted in any medium without royalty provided # the copyright notice and this notice are preserved. AC_DEFUN([AX_C_ARITHMETIC_RSHIFT], [ AC_CACHE_CHECK([whether right shift operation is arithmetic], [ax_cv_c_arithmetic_rshift], [AC_COMPILE_IFELSE([[int dummy[((-1 >> 1) < 0) ? 1 : -1];]], [ax_cv_c_arithmetic_rshift=yes], [ax_cv_c_arithmetic_rshift=no])]) if test "x$ax_cv_c_arithmetic_rshift" = xyes; then AC_DEFINE([HAVE_ARITHMETIC_RSHIFT], [1], [Define to 1 if the right shift operation is arithmetic.]) fi ])
